Grazer Schlossberg

According to the Guinness Book of World Records, the Schlossberg was the world's strongest fortress ever. Unfortunately, Napoleon commissioned the demolition of the fortress and only a few buildings were saved by locals. The Schlossberg is still worth a visit nonetheless. Whether you come for attractions and events within the mountain (slide, performances) or you want to enjoy the view over Graz, the Schlossberg remains a visitor attraction until this day.
